Johnson & Johnson has more than 250 companies located in 57 countries around the world. Our Family of Companies is organized into several business segments comprised of franchises and therapeutic categories.
The Consumer segment includes a broad range of products used in the baby care, skin care, oral care, wound care and women’s health care fields, as well as nutritional and over-the-counter pharmaceutical products, and wellness and prevention platforms.
The Medical Devices and Diagnostics segment produces a broad range of innovative products used primarily by health care professionals in the fields of orthopaedics, neurovascular, surgery, vision care, diabetes care, infection prevention, diagnostics, cardiovascular disease, sports medicine, and aesthetics. This segment is comprised of our Global Medical Solutions, Global Orthopaedics and Global Surgery Groups.
The Pharmaceutical segment’s broad portfolio focuses on unmet medical needs across several therapeutic areas: cardiovascular & metabolism, immunology, infectious diseases & vaccines, neuroscience & pain, and oncology.
